Patent number: 9439742Abstract: An electric toothbrush includes an inner case, made up of an inner case main body and a motor holder, mounted with various components including a motor; an outer case which interiorly accommodates the inner case and which acts as a portion the user grips with hand when brushing teeth; an eccentric shaft, configured by a shaft main body and an eccentric member, which center of gravity is arranged at a position shifted from a shaft center and which rotates by a drive force of the motor; and a vibration transmitting component for transmitting the vibration generated with the rotation of the eccentric shaft to a brush portion; where the vibration transmitting component is positioned with respect to the outer case by point contacting the inner wall surface of the outer case at a plurality of locations.Type: GrantFiled: June 25, 2014Date of Patent: September 13, 2016Assignee: OMRON HEALTHCARE Co., Ltd.Inventors: Jun Shimoyama, Yasutaka Murase, Tadashi Tone, Yuji Asada

Patent number: 7212659Abstract: An apparatus for measuring biological data such as blood pressure of a user has a pulse detector for simultaneously obtaining fingerprint data and a first signal from the user's body such as a pulse wave signal. The fingerprint data are used to check if the user is a registered user. After the user's biological data such as pulse waves are measured and a second signal is obtained from the user, the first and second signals are compared to check if this is the same user from whom the fingerprint data were taken in order to prevent the apparatus from being used by a wrong person. Comparison may be made between the first signal and a pattern of pulse waves extracted from earlier obtained pulse waves stored in a memory. Similar components may be used for an exercising machine to prevent it from being used by a person not preliminarily registered or a person different from the one who passed the fingerprint test on the machine.Type: GrantFiled: April 3, 2003Date of Patent: May 1, 2007Assignee: Omron CorporationInventors: Shinya Noro, Takehiro Hamaguchi, Takefumi Nakanishi, Yasutaka Murase, Susumu Minamikawa

Publication number: 20030092976Abstract: An interactive medical diagnostic device includes control, display, input and memory devices. Dosage data related to administration of medicaments given to a patient and physiological values obtained by measurement from the patient are stored, and an interactive medical examination is carried out by outputting questions to and receiving answers from the patient. These data are compared and propriety of the current treatment of the patient is determined and outputted. Either data on prescribed dosage or those on actually administered dosage may be used by the control device. During the interactive medical examination, the patient may be allowed to review the earlier posed questions and supplied responses. The answers may be given not only in terms of “yes” and “no” but also as “neither.Type: ApplicationFiled: November 4, 2002Publication date: May 15, 2003Applicant: OMRON CorporationInventors: Yasutaka Murase, Takehiro Hamaguchi, Takefumi Nakanishi, Shinya Noro, Susumu Minamikawa
